1. What is a Gypsum Retarder?
A gypsum retarder is a specialized chemical additive designed to adjust and extend the setting time of gypsum slurries. Its primary goal is to provide sufficient "open time" for workers to apply, level, and finish the material without compromising the final structural integrity.

The Mechanism: How It Works
The hydration of gypsum is a process of dissolution and recrystallization. When a retarder is introduced:
-
Nucleation Inhibition: The retarder molecules adsorb onto the surfaces of hemihydrate particles, delaying the formation of dihydrate gypsum nuclei.
-
Crystal Growth Delay: By coating the nascent crystals, the additive slows down the interlocking process of the hydration products, maintaining the fluidity of the mix.
2. Key Types of Gypsum Retarders
Different gypsum sources (Natural vs. FGD/Desulfurized gypsum) require specific retarding solutions. Here are the most common types available in the market:

Organic Acids and Their Salts
Includes Citric Acid and Tartaric Acid.
-
Pros: Highly effective at very low dosages and cost-efficient.
-
Cons: Excessive dosage can lead to a drastic drop in the final hardness of the gypsum.
Inorganic Phosphates
Often used as pre-treatment for industrial byproduct gypsum to stabilize its initial setting behavior.

5. Dosage and Usage Guidelines

-
Pre-Mixing: It is highly recommended to dry-mix the retarder with the gypsum powder thoroughly before adding water.
-
Dosage Precision: Setting time increases exponentially with dosage. Always perform a small-scale lab test to determine the optimal ratio for your specific gypsum source.
-
Temperature Sensitivity: High ambient temperatures accelerate setting. Adjust the dosage accordingly during summer or in tropical climates.
